Are Narcissists hooked on currently being famous?

Respond to:

You guess. This, undoubtedly, is their predominant push. Staying famous encompasses a few crucial functions: it endows the narcissist with ability, ΔΙΣΚΟΓΡΑΦΙΚΕΣ ΤΗΛΕΦΩΝΑ offers him with a continuing Source of Narcissistic Source (admiration, adoration, acceptance, awe), and fulfils significant Ego features.

image

The picture which the narcissist initiatives is hurled back again at him, reflected by Those people exposed to his celebrity or fame. Using this method he feels alive, his quite existence is affirmed and he acquires a sensation of distinct boundaries (where by the narcissist ends and the globe begins).

You will find there's list of narcissistic behaviours usual for the pursuit of superstar. There is almost nothing which the narcissist refrains from executing, Just about no borders that he hesitates to cross to accomplish renown. To him, there isn't any such factor as “bad publicity” what issues would be to be in the public eye.

Since the narcissist Similarly enjoys all sorts of consideration and likes just as much to get feared as to become cherished, As an example he doesn’t brain if what exactly is published about him is wrong (“given that they spell my name properly”). The narcissist’s only bad emotional stretches are all through periods of deficiency of notice, publicity, or publicity.

The narcissist then feels vacant, hollowed out, negligible, humiliated, wrathful, discriminated from, deprived, neglected, handled unjustly and so forth. At first, he tries to get consideration from ever narrowing teams of reference (“provide scale down”). But the sensation that he's compromising gnaws at his anyhow fragile self-esteem.

Faster or later on, the spring bursts. The narcissist plots, contrives, options, conspires, thinks, analyses, synthesises and does what ever else is necessary to regain the shed publicity in the general public eye. The greater he fails to protected the eye of the concentrate on group (generally the most important) the more daring, eccentric and outlandish he will become. Agency final decision to be recognised is remodeled into resolute action and after that to some panicky pattern of notice seeking behaviours.

The narcissist is not really enthusiastic about publicity for every se. Narcissists are misleading. The narcissist seems to like himself and, genuinely, he abhors himself. Equally, he seems to have an interest in becoming a celebrity and, In fact, he is worried about the REACTIONS to his fame: men and women watch him, discover him, discuss him, discussion his steps thus he exists.

The narcissist goes all over “searching and collecting” the way the expressions on folks’s faces alter when they see him. He destinations himself for the centre of awareness, or whilst a figure of controversy. He continuously and recurrently pesters Those people closest and dearest to him inside a bid to reassure himself that he is not dropping his fame, his magic touch, the attention of his social milieu.

Really, the narcissist isn't choosy. If he may become well-known to be a author he writes, if for a businessman he conducts company. He switches from one subject to the other without difficulty and without having regret simply because in all of them he is present with out conviction, bar the conviction that he have to (and deserves to) get well known.

He grades routines, hobbies and folks not in accordance with the enjoyment that they provide him but In line with their utility: can they or can’t they make him recognized and, If that's so, to what extent. The narcissist is a person-observe minded (not to mention obsessive). His is actually a entire world of black (becoming unfamiliar and deprived of notice) and white (currently being well-known and celebrated).

Mistreating Celebs – An Job interview

Granted to Superinteressante Journal in Brazil

Q. Fame and TV demonstrates about celebrities usually Have a very enormous viewers. This is often understandable: people today want to see other effective folks. But why people today prefer to see superstars becoming humiliated?

A. So far as their fans are anxious, celebrities fulfil two psychological features: they provide a mythical narrative (a story that the supporter can stick to and establish with) and they perform as blank screens onto which the fans undertaking their goals, hopes, fears, options, values, and needs (wish fulfilment). The slightest deviation from these prescribed roles provokes enormous rage and can make us want to punish (humiliate) the “deviant” stars.

But why?

If the human foibles, vulnerabilities, and frailties of a star are revealed, the fan feels humiliated, “cheated”, hopeless, and “empty”. To reassert his self-really worth, the admirer should build his or her ethical superiority above the erring and “sinful” celeb. The fan will have to “instruct the celebrity a lesson” and present the movie star “who’s boss”. It's a primitive protection mechanism – narcissistic grandiosity. It places the enthusiast on equivalent footing With all the uncovered and “bare” celeb.

Q. This taste for viewing a person remaining humiliated has something to complete with the attraction to catastrophes and tragedies?

A. There is always a sadistic satisfaction as well as a morbid fascination in vicarious suffering. Currently being spared the pains and tribulations Other people go through can make the observer come to feel “chosen”, safe, and virtuous. The upper famous people increase, the more challenging they tumble. There is a thing gratifying in hubris defied and punished.

Q. Do you think the viewers place themselves during the position with the reporter (when he asks a thing embarrassing to a celebrity) and become in some way revenged?

A. The reporter “represents” the “bloodthirsty” community. Belittling celebrities or seeing their comeuppance is the trendy equivalent with the gladiator rink. Gossip accustomed to fulfil the identical functionality and now the mass media broadcast Stay the slaughtering of fallen gods. There is no issue of revenge below – just Schadenfreude, the responsible Pleasure of witnessing your superiors penalized and “Slice down to dimensions”.

7. I believe the enthusiast-superstar romance gratifies both sides. Exactly what are the advantages the enthusiasts get and What exactly are the advantages the celebrities get?

A. You can find an implicit agreement between a star and his admirers. The celebrity is obliged to “act the part”, to fulfil the anticipations of his admirers, to not deviate with the roles that they impose and he or she accepts. In return the enthusiasts shower the movie star with adulation. They idolize him or her and make him or her really feel omnipotent, immortal, “greater than daily life”, omniscient, top-quality, and sui generis (exclusive).

What exactly are the admirers having for their difficulty?

Over all, the opportunity to vicariously share the celeb’s fabulous (and, ordinarily, partly confabulated) existence. The movie star gets their “agent” in fantasyland, their extension and proxy, the reification and embodiment in their deepest wishes and many key and responsible desires. Quite a few celebs are purpose products or father/mother figures. Stars are evidence that there's far more to everyday living than drab and routine. That wonderful – nay, ideal – men and women do exist and they do direct charmed lives. There’s hope but – This can be the movie star’s concept to his followers.

The celeb’s inescapable downfall and corruption is the modern-day equal in the medieval morality play. This trajectory – from rags to riches and fame and back again to rags or even worse – proves that buy and justice do prevail, that hubris invariably receives punished, and that the celebrity isn't any much better, neither is he superior, to his fans.

8. Why are superstars narcissists? How is this dysfunction born?

Nobody appreciates if pathological narcissism is the outcome of inherited characteristics, the sad result of abusive and traumatizing upbringing, or perhaps the confluence of the two. Normally, in the same relatives, Using the same list of mom and dad and A similar emotional environment – some siblings develop to get malignant narcissists, while others are beautifully “typical”. Undoubtedly, this means a genetic predisposition of many people to establish narcissism.

It would seem reasonable to presume – even though, at this stage, There is certainly not a shred of proof – that the narcissist is born that has a propensity to develop narcissistic defenses. These are definitely brought on by abuse or trauma through the childhood in infancy or during early adolescence. By “abuse” I'm referring into a spectrum of behaviors which objectify the child and address it as an extension of your caregiver (mother or father) or as being a mere instrument of gratification. Dotting and smothering are as abusive as beating and starving. And abuse can be dished out by peers in addition to by dad and mom, or by Grownup function types.

Not all celebrities are narcissists. Even now, a number of them surely are.

All of us hunt for constructive cues from men and women about us. These cues reinforce in us sure conduct patterns. There is nothing Exclusive in the fact that the narcissist-celeb does a similar. Nevertheless There's two major discrepancies involving the narcissistic and the traditional persona.

The main is quantitative. The normal man or woman is likely to welcome a moderate quantity of notice verbal and non-verbal in the shape of affirmation, acceptance, or admiration. An excessive amount of notice, although, is perceived as onerous and is avoided. Destructive and detrimental criticism is averted completely.

The narcissist, in distinction, is the mental equal of an alcoholic. He's insatiable. He directs his full conduct, actually his lifestyle, to acquire these pleasurable titbits of interest. He embeds them in a very coherent, totally biased, photo of himself. He utilizes them to regulates his labile (fluctuating) sense of self-worth and self-esteem.

To elicit frequent interest, the narcissist tasks on to others a confabulated, fictitious version of himself, known as the Fake Self. The Phony Self is all the things the narcissist is not really: omniscient, omnipotent, charming, intelligent, abundant, or nicely-connected.

The narcissist then proceeds to reap reactions to this projected graphic from relatives, mates, co-workers, neighbours, company partners and from colleagues. If these the adulation, admiration, interest, dread, respect, applause, affirmation are usually not forthcoming, the narcissist calls for them, or extorts them. Dollars, compliments, a favourable critique, an overall look inside the media, a sexual conquest are all transformed in the similar forex during the narcissist’s intellect, into “narcissistic supply”.

So, the narcissist is probably not keen on publicity for every se or in becoming well-known. Truly He's concerned with the REACTIONS to his fame: how persons look at him, notice him, look at him, discussion his steps. It “proves” to him that he exists.
